Driving positive change: How CSR Initiatives benefit Companies and Communities
Recently, WestProp Holdings handed over a room at Rainbow Children’s Village, a home which seeks to provide support for children who are cancer patients. Founded in 2017, Rainbow Children’s Village offers a restorative home where the young cancer patients can recover, be monitored and recuperate from treatment.
The room that was handed over by WestProp Holdings, aptly named Tadiwa, was dedicated to the firstborn of one of our team members. Tadiwa braved leukaemia but lost the fight as a child. The room, now a representation of our contribution, will carry on Tadiwa’s legacy and that of many others, helping other children fighting cancer.?

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) is becoming increasingly important in today's business landscape. CSR involves considering the interests of various stakeholders, including employees, customers, suppliers, communities, and the broader society while making business decisions. While some might argue that CSR is merely a marketing ploy, it is, in fact, an essential aspect of modern businesses for several reasons.
I can proudly say that at WestProp, our CSR initiatives are not about ticking a box. We genuinely care about improving the lives of those less privileged in our community and we go above and beyond to leave a long-lasting positive impact. WestProp gives back 10 percent of its profits to the community, intending to help disadvantaged groups, mainly orphans and widows.
Firstly, CSR helps build a positive brand image. In an era where information spreads rapidly through social media and consumers are more conscious than ever, a company's reputation can make or break its success. Customers are increasingly choosing brands aligned with their values and actively supporting those that demonstrate genuine commitment to social and environmental causes. By demonstrating a strong CSR strategy, a company can differentiate itself from competitors, attract more customers, and build brand loyalty. This positive perception can lead to increased sales, as consumers prefer to associate themselves with organizations that have a positive impact on society.

Furthermore, embracing CSR is crucial for long-term business sustainability. At Westprop, we embrace the ESG framework (Environment, Social and Governance), and our community engagements help us to ensure that the business prioritizes giving back to the communities around us. Last year, we adopted a nearby park, Greenwood Park and we revived the park to provide an outdoor leisure space where the surrounding community can relax. Holistically, embracing the ESG framework ensures our company's survival in a rapidly changing business landscape and also contributes to a more sustainable and equitable world.
The importance of CSR is also evident in the positive impact it has on local communities. Businesses operate within societal structures, and their actions can significantly influence the communities they are a part of. By actively engaging in community development programs, such as supporting local schools, healthcare facilities, or social initiatives, companies can contribute to the welfare of the communities they operate in. These efforts not only improve the lives of community members but also build trust and positive relationships with stakeholders. Engaging with communities in a responsible manner adds value and helps businesses become legitimate and respected members of society.
The number of CSR initiatives that we take part in is far too many to list here all of them here, but in 2023 WestProp Holdings lent a helping hand to several organisations including Nyararai Children’s Trust, Harare Children’s Home, Parirenyatwa Hospital and Elim Mission. In total, we assisted over 150 individuals through paying school fees, capital investments in small to medium-scale businesses, building materials, stationery donations, grocery donations and health care equipment donations.?
